You seem to be assuming that the issue is around factual correctness, and that may be the case but the evidence we have so far doesn't support jumping to such a narrow cause.
Is the poor performance because the LLMs are frequently wrong? Unknown.
Is it because the LLMs are sycophantic? Unknown.
Is it because the chat interface is a poor one for learning? Unknown.
What we do know is that students who rely on LLMs learn less and perform worse in the long term. And that alone is enough evidence to support a ban. If better tools come along in the future and are shown to aid learning, then the ban can be re-evaluated.
